Dillon County, South Carolina has 4 power plants totaling 15 MW of nameplate capacity. Browse every plant below with fuel type, operator, and capacity.
| Plant | City | Fuel | Capacity | Operator |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Whitetail Solar | Dillon | Solar | 10.0 MW | Solriver Capital Llc |
| Freedom Solar | Nichols | Solar | 5.0 MW | Freedom Solar, Llc |
| Cotton Solar | Dillon | Solar | — MW | Cotton Solar, Llc |
| Melsam Solar | Dillon | Solar | — MW | Melsam Solar |
Dillon County, South Carolina has 4 power plants totaling 15 MW of nameplate capacity. Solar is the dominant fuel source at 100% of installed capacity. The largest facility is Whitetail Solar at 10 MW. Data comes from EIA Form 860, EIA Form 923, and EPA eGRID federal releases.
